What this coin is
The Mexico gold 5 pesos is the CINCO PESOS Hidalgo. 4.1666 g, .900 fine, 0.12057 oz AGW (Banco de México). About 19 mm. Shops call it a half Hidalgo.
What is written on the coin
CINCO PESOS, Hidalgo, eagle-and-snake, ESTADOS UNIDOS MEXICANOS on later legend style, Mo mintmark. Type cinco or cinco pesos if that is what you can read.
Metal content (the melt spec)
Mint specification: 4.1666 grams at 90% fine, which is 0.12057 troy oz of pure gold (AGW). Formula: grams × fineness ÷ 31.1034768. Date and mintmark do not change that number. Melt today is $531.00 per coin at $4,404.10 gold.
Mintage
Circulation issues 1905–1920 with gaps, later dates including 1955, plus official restrikes. Common dates trade near gold; better grade and scarce dates sell above melt.
A little history
Miguel Hidalgo y Costilla is the usual portrait on the 5 and 10 peso gold. Same .900 alloy as the rest of the peso gold set.
How to tell you have this type
CINCO PESOS in gold. A silver coin that says CINCO PESOS is the Cuauhtémoc or Hidalgo silver 5 pesos — much larger and not gold.

Questions people ask
How much pure gold is in a Mexico gold 5 pesos (CINCO PESOS)?
Mint spec is 4.167 grams at 90% fine, which is 0.12057 troy oz of pure gold (AGW). Date and mintmark do not change that.

How many Mexico gold 5 pesos (CINCO PESOS)s equal one ounce of gold?
About 8.29 coins equal 1.00 troy oz of pure gold at mint weight.
Does mintmark change the melt value?
No. Mintmark and date do not change the metal for this composition. A Mexico City (Mo) piece and another mint of the same spec have the same melt. Collector premiums still follow date, mint, and grade.
